OK SB1212 | 2018 | Regular Session

Status

Spectrum: Partisan Bill (Republican 31-1)
Status: Vetoed on May 11 2018 - 100% progression
Action: 2018-05-11 - Vetoed 05/11/2018
Text: Latest bill text (Enrolled) [PDF]

Summary

Firearms; modifying inclusions on unlawful carry; allowing firearms to be carried without a license. Effective date.
